Understanding Allergic Reactions & Finding Safe Dog Treats
Many canine guardians notice their pooches exhibiting signs of reactions, which can be troubling for everyone. Typical allergic manifestations in dogs might include itchiness, gastrointestinal distress, and ear troubles. Identifying potential allergens, particularly those found in kibble or yummies, is vital for their well-being. Finding safe treats requires meticulous label reading and a consideration of ingredients. Here's how to navigate the process:
- Elimination Diet: Your veterinarian may recommend a specialized diet to identify offending ingredients.
- Ingredient Awareness: Be cautious of common allergens like gluten, maize, legumes, and milk products.
- Limited Ingredient Treats: Select treats with a short list of recognizable ingredients.
- Hypoallergenic Options: Look for treats specifically designated as "hypoallergenic," but always double-check the ingredient list.
- Consult a Professional: Your area veterinarian can provide individual advice and recommendations for your dog's specific needs.
Always keep in mind that every canine is unique, and what's okay for one may won't be for another. Regular monitoring and conversation with your veterinary specialist are essential to ensuring your dog's continued happiness and general health.
